Deploying Certificates to Users and Computers

The following sections provide recommendations for deploying the necessary certificates for 802.1x authentication for wireless and wired networks.

RADIUS Server

When implementing 802.1x authentication, it is recommended you use Microsoft Windows Server 2003 Internet Authentication Service (IAS) as the RADIUS server. The implementation of a computer running Windows Server 2003 enables you to restrict certificate-based authentication to certificates with a designated OID, such as a custom application policy OID.
